Technical details
- Diameter: 266mm
- Type: Disc Brake Rotor (Single)
- Material: High-quality cast iron
- Manufactured to meet or exceed OEM standards
- Weight: Approximately 4.5 kg

How often should I replace my brake rotors?
Brake rotors should be inspected regularly and replaced when they show signs of wear such as warping, cracking, or excessive thickness variation.
